General place words

Come here, please [to me, to where I am]

Have you ever been to Peru? I’m going there in May [to another place, not

here]

I’m coming back from Vietnam in April [returning here, to this place again] There are books and papers everywhere in my room [in all parts / all places]

(See Unit 7.)

Positions

ni

the middle of theroad the bottom of the glass

the front of the car the side of the car the back of the car

the book

Left and right

his left hand his right hand

On Main Street, there is a pharmacy on the left and a restaurant on the right

Home and away

Is Mary home / at home? [in her house/apartment]

No, she’s out [shopping / at work / at school]

No, she’s away [in another town/city or country]

No, she’s out of town [in another town or city]

Mary is going abroad next year [to another country]

Manner = how we do something or the way we do something

Fast and slow

This car goes very fast It’s a fast car This car goes very slowly It’s a slow

car

Right and wrong

This sentence is right [correct] I like coffee very much

This sentence is wrong [not correct] I like very much coffee *N

Loud and quiet

The music is too loud It’s very quiet here

The teacher speaks very quietly We can’t hear him

She sang loudly [Her voice was loud.]

She’s a good swimmer She swims well He’s a bad swimmer He swims badly

Way

Way means how someone does something

Most English verbs are regular, but some common verbs in English are

irregular The forms here are the base form (have, go, get), the past tense (had, went, got), and the past participle (had, gone, gotten) When you learn a new irregular verb, add it to one of the groups of verbs on this page

ợ All forms the same

<>

ap Three different forms

*The three forms of read are all spelled the same but not pronounced the same

**Pay/paid/paid are irregular in spelling but not in pronunciation

***The vowel in said is pronounced differently from the vowel in paid

(See pages 126-127 for a list of irregular verbs.)
